Startup

This chapter describes how to start up the Active Front End. For a brief
description of the HIM (Human Interface Module), see

Appendix B

.

The basic start-up procedure must be performed when starting a new AFE to
verify the condition of the unit, and to configure essential parameters for
operating the AFE.

Because the names of the switches, pushbuttons, and status indicators are
different for an AFE in a IP20 2500 MCC Style enclosure than an AFE in a IP21
Rittal enclosure, see the appropriate subsection.

AFE in IP20 2500 MCC Style
Enclosure

This procedure requires that a HIM be installed. If an operator interface is not
available, remote devices must be used to start up the AFE.

Startup Procedure

Before Applying Power to the AFE

1.

Verify that the input circuit breaker is off.

2.

Confirm that all wiring to the AFE (AC Input, ground, DC bus, and I/O)
is connected to the correct AFE terminals and is secure.

3.

Verify that AC line power at the disconnect device is within the rated value
of the AFE.

ATTENTION: Power must be applied to the Active Front End to perform the
following start-up procedure. Some of the voltages present are at incoming line
potential. To avoid electric shock hazard or damage to equipment, only qualified
service personnel must perform the following procedure. Thoroughly read and
understand the procedure before beginning. If an event does not occur while
performing this procedure, do not proceed. Remove power, including user-
supplied control voltages. User-supplied voltages can exist even when main AC
power is not applied to the AFE. Correct the malfunction before continuing.
